Immunogen: AT5G08050 Q9SD79 Synonyms: RIQ1 Background:
RIQ proteins contribute to NPQ and grana stacking in ways different from those of CURT1 functions, they may directly regulate the extent of grana stacking and, consequently, the optimization of the LHCII organization. RIQ proteins contain RIQ1 (AT5G08050) and RIQ2 (AT1G74730). -

Immunogen: AT5G03740 Q9LZR5 Synonyms: HDT3, HDT3, HD2C, HISTONE DEACETYLASE 2C, HISTONE DEACETYLASE 3 Background:
The four HD2 proteins of Arabidopsis thaliana (AtHD2A-D) belong to a unique class of histone deacetylases that is plant specific. Histone deacetylation gives a tag for epigenetic repression and plays an important role in transcriptional regulation, cell cycle progression and developmental events, and it is involved in the modulation of abscisic acid and stress-responsive genes. -

Immunogen: AT1G02280 O23680 Synonyms: TOC33, ATTOC33, PLASTID PROTEIN IMPORT 1, PPI1, TRANSLOCON AT THE OUTER ENVELOPE MEMBRANE OF CHLOROPLASTS 33 Background:
TOC33 (AT1G02280) is a component of the chloroplast protein import machinery, which consists of three core components, namely the pore-forming Toc75 (AT1G35860, AT3G46740, AT4G09080, AT5G19620) and two GTPases Toc33 (AT1G02280) and Toc159 (AT4G02510). Toc33 and Toc159 may regulate precursor protein perception and their transport to the translocation pore. -

Immunogen: AT3G48530 Q8LBB2 Synonyms: KING1, KINGAMMA, SNF1-RELATED PROTEIN KINASE REGULATORY SUBUNIT GAMMA 1 Background:
The SNF1-related protein kinase 1 (SnRK1) is the plant orthologue of the evolutionarily-conserved SNF1/AMPK/SnRK1 protein kinase family that contribute to maintaining cellular energy homeostasis. -

Immunogen: AT2G21870 Q9SJ12 Synonyms: ATP-FAD, MGP1, MALE GAMETOPHYTE DEFECTIVE 1 Background:
Mitochondrial F0F1-ATP synthase is also called Complex V and it synthesis ATP from ADP and Pi using the proton motive force created by respiratory electron transport. ATP-FAD (AT2G21870) is a subunit of mitochondrial F0F1-ATP synthase in Arabidopsis. -
